Download Full Dataset (.xlsx)Latest updates. On a sesonally unadjusted basis, in the United States, shipments of primary metals were 32.65 USD billion in June 2026, compared to 30.95 in May 2026. This marks a gain of 5.49 percent.
Sample. The monthly series presented in the graph has a total of 414 records. The series covers the period stretching from January 1992 to June 2026.
History. Here's a peek at a few descriptive statistics computed on the whole sample: shipments recorded a bottom of 9.09 USD billion in December 1992; they recorded their highest level of 32.65 in June 2026; they were equal on average to 18.11.
